Documentos de Académico
Documentos de Profesional
Documentos de Cultura
Curso LTE
3. Arquitectura funcional y protocolos
Manuel Alvarez-Campana
mac@dit.upm.es
Indice
Introducción
Arquitectura
Protocolos
Procedimientos
Tráfico cursado
Smartphones Datos
Modems
HSPA
Voz
Tiempo
Iu-CS
Node-B RNC VLR
Iub A Dominio CS
MSC GSM 64 kbit/s GMSC
Iu
Node-B Iur
Red SS7 HLR
Uu RNC Iu-PS
(W-CDMA) Gb
Dominio PS
SGSN GPRS GTP/IP GGSN
Infraestructura nueva:acceso radio
WCDMA y transporte ATM
arquitectura “Todo-IP”
(caudal, latencia)
Mejores prestaciones
• Subsistema IP multimedia (IMS)
Evolución hacia
Rel 5 • QoS extremo a extremo en dominio PS
(mar 02) • Red de acceso IP
• High Speed Downlink Packet Access (HSPDA)
···
Alternativa IP
para UTRAN
La idea era buena… pero el resultado final es complejo y poco eficiente, debido al
enfoque “cortar y pegar” reutilizando tecnologías previas (algunas obsoletas)
n x E1 n x E1 ATM
n x E1 E1
E1 2xE1 E1
ATM
RNC E1
E1
2xE1
E1 ATM
2xE1
E1
E1
Tecnología ATM potente, pero
E1
compleja y “obsoleta”. No es IP.
Problemas a resolver:
– Eficiencia
• sobrecarga de cabeceras IP
• multiplexión tráfico de varios usuarios
– Retardo: Solución de difícil
• segmentación de paquetes
aplicación práctica
• mecanismos QoS en IP (Diffserv)
– Interfuncionamiento con equipos ATM-UTRAN
Obsolescencia de la
INAP CAP MAP
conmutación de circuitos
ISUP AuC
TCAP
SCP EIR HLR (H)
SCCP F D
Red SS7
ISUP
Iu-CS Circuitos
(B)
Otras
RNC redes
64 Kbit/s
UE RANAP MSC GMSC
Node B Iub ISUP
TRAU IWF
Capa de
Señalización
MSC BICC GMSC Control
Voz
Server Server SIGTRAN
RANAP H.248
Control H.248 SG
Capa de ISUP
transporte
Iu-CS Red IP
UE
NodeB 138.4.0.0/16
SGSN
Backbone ATM
138.4.0.15 10.0.0.1
Internet
Backbone
IP GGSN
10.0.0.3
SGSN
10.0.0.2
Portadora Radio Túnel GTP Túnel GTP
Paquete IP/IP
Marzo 2015 Curso LTE ‐ ISDEFE 12
Subsistema IP multimedia (Rel-5)
Capa de Servicios
Incluye VoIP sobre Dominio PS.
¿Podemos prescindir de Dominio CS? HSS CSE
Servidores
de aplicación
MAP,
AAA,
LDAP, CAP
SIP
···
CSCF Call Session Control Function
MGCF Media Gateway Control Function
MGW Media Gateway Capa de Control
TSGW Trunk Signalling Gateway
HSS Home Subscriber Server IMS SIP
CSCF MGCF SIGTRAN
Mg
TSWG
SIP H.248 Mc
ISUP
Dominio TDM
UTRAN SGSN PS GGSN MGW RTC
Internet
Marzo 2015 Curso LTE ‐ ISDEFE
13
Tecnologías HSPA
(High Speed Packet Access)
OFDM
Frecuencia
Canales de
transporte
BCH DL-SCH PCH RACH UL-SCH
Canales
físicos
PBCH PDSCH PDCCH PHICH PRACH PUSCH PUCCH
Downlink Uplink
A nivel físico y de transporte, casi todos los canales se mapean
sobre los canales compartidos UL-SCH y DL-SCH
Marzo 2015 Curso LTE ‐ ISDEFE 20
Acceso múltiple OFDMA
(Orthogonal Frequency Division Multiple Access)
* En sentido ascendente se usa SC-FDMA (Single Carrier Frequency Division Multiplex Access), variante de
OFDMA con preprocesado digital que permite transmitir sobre una sola portadora, minimizando el consumo de
energía del terminal.
Introducción
Arquitectura
– Red de acceso (E-UTRAN)
– Núcleo de red (EPC)
Protocolos
Procedimientos
Interfaz …
Radio
eNodeB
(E-UTRA)
Desaparición de:
– dominio de circuitos Núcleo de Red
– red señalización SS7 Dominio CS
– controladores radio MSC/VLR GMSC
Circuitos RTC/
64 Kbit/s RDSI
Arquitectura IP
“plana”
AuC
HLR Red SS7
Red de Acceso ISUP+MAP SMSC
EIR
Uu Nodo-B
Gi Internet/
Iub Iu-PS Backbone
Nodo-B SGSN GGSN Intranet
IP
RNC Dominio PS
Introducción
Arquitectura
– Red de acceso (E-UTRAN)
– Núcleo de red (EPC)
Procedimientos
Backhaul Móvil
Estaciones base Última milla Red de agregación Núcleo de red
Radioenlaces
Cobre
Fibra
E-Line
S1 MME/
E-LAN SGW
LTE LTE LTE X2 S1
IP/Eth. IP/Eth. IP/Eth. IP/Eth.
eNodeB eNodeB eNodeB
LTE
IP/Eth.
IP/Eth.
eNodeB
Hub
LTE IP/Eth.
Radioenlaces
eNodeB
Soluciones Ethernet
IP/Eth. IP/Eth. Cobre
en Última Milla
LTE LTE
Fibra
eNodeB eNodeB
Múltiples opciones
MPLS LSP
Eth PW PW Eth
IP/MPLS Eth.+PW+LSP
(nivel 3)
BFD, RSVP-TE/LDP, FRR
Fabricantes vs. operadores
T-LDP/BFD, VCCV Mundo Internet vs. mundo carrier
802.1ag, 802.3ah, Y.1731
MPLS-TP LSP
Eth PW PW Eth
Eth.+PW+LSP
MPLS-TP
(nivel 2,5) BFD, Protection Protocol
BFD, VCCV
802.1ag, 802.3ah, Y.1731
Túnel PBB-TE
Eth Eth
PBB-TE Ethernet
(nivel 2)
G.8031, 802.1ag, 802.3ah, Y.1731
Introducción
Arquitectura
Red de acceso (E‐UTRAN)
– Núcleo de red (EPC)
Protocolos
Procedimientos
Pueden residir en
el mismo equipo
Red IP de trasporte
subyacente
Policy Charging
PCRF and Rules Function
- Gestión de políticas de QoS y tarificación
PDN PDN
SGi
SGi
PDN GW
PGW
S5
PGW MME
S6a S11 SGW + PGW S6a
HSS MME SGW HSS MME + SGW
SGW
S1-C S1-U S1
EUTRAN EUTRAN
UE UE
Introducción
Arquitectura
Protocolos
– Protocolos del interfaz radio
– Protocolos del interfaz S1
– Protolos del núcleo de red
Procedimientos
S1-C MME
eNodeB
UE
S1-U SGW
SGW
Plano de Portadora de acceso radio (E-RAB)
Usuario
DRB/DTCH S1 Bearer (túnel IP)
Tráfico (IP)
Móvil/SGW
SRB Signalling Radio Bearer eNodeB Evolved NodeB
DRB Data Radio Bearer ERAB EUTRAN Radio Access Bearer
DCCH Dedicated Control Channel SGW Serving Gateway
DTCH Dedicated Traffic Channel MME Mobility Management Entity
UE User Equipment
NAS NAS
RRC RRC S1-AP S1-AP
Plano de PDCP PDCP SCTP SCTP
Control RLC RLC IP IP
(señalización) MAC MAC L2 L2
PHY PHY L1 L1
EUTRA S1-C
UE (LTE-Uu) eNB MME
IP IP
PDCP PDCP GTP-U GTP-U
Plano de
Usuario RLC RLC UDP/IP UDP/IP
(tráfico de MAC MAC L2 L2
usuario) PHY PHY L1 L1
EUTRA S1-U
UE (LTE-Uu) eNB SGW
1) Compresión de cabeceras IP
– RoHC: Robust Header Compression
(IETF RFC 4995)
– Varias opciones, según datos a transportar
• Voz: RTP/UDP/IP
• Web: TCP/IP
• …
UE eNB
buffer
buffer
buffer
• PRB (Physical Resource Blocks) ···
– con qué velocidad:
• MCS (Modulation & Coding Scheme) Scheduler Multiplexado
Decisión basada en:
Modulación y
– condiciones radio del enlace DL con UE codificación
• CQI (Channel Quality Indicator)
– cantidad de datos encolados
– requisitos de QoS CQI TF DL-SCH
• prioridades de UEs y aplicaciones
Notificación a UEs sobre PDCCH
UE
buffer
buffer
buffer
···
sirve sobre los recursos asignados
UE
PDCP H H H ···
RLC H H ···
MAC H Relleno
Introducción
Arquitectura
Protocolos
– Protocolos del interfaz radio
– Protocolos del interfaz S1
– Protolos del núcleo de red
Procedimientos
Interfaces diferentes según plano considerado: S1-C (p. control) y S1-U (p.
usuario) NAS
S1-AP
SCTP
Interfaz S1-C: señalización S1-AP (S1 Application Part) IP
L2
– Gestión de recursos radio, avisos, traspasos, etc. L1
– Más envío transparente de señalización de usuario NAS EPC
– Transporte fiable con SCTP (Streaming Transmission UE EUTRAN
S1-C MME
Control Protocol) [RFC 2960]
– Similar a BSSAP (GSM) y RANAP (UMTS)
eNodeB
S1-U SGW
Introducción
Arquitectura
Protocolos
– Protocolos del interfaz radio
– Protocolos del interfaz S1
– Protolos del núcleo de red
Procedimientos
GTP-C DIAMETER
NAS UDP SCTP
S1-AP IP IP
SCTP L2 L2
IP L1 L1
L2
L1 HSS EPC
S6a PCRF
EUTRAN S11
UE S1-C MME Gx Rx
S5 Redes
S1-U SGW PGW SGi de datos
eNodeB
GTP-U GTP-U
UDP UDP
IP IP Datos + Señalización
L2 L2 Señalización
L1 L1
Especie de «circuito virtual» con QoS entre móvil y red externa (SGi)
– Similar a contexto PDP de GPRS/UMTS
– Establecimiento previo vía señalización (gestión de sesiones)
– Reconfigurables en caso de movilidad (gestión de movilidad)
– Hasta once portadoras EPS establecidas simultáneamente
HTTP HTTP
TCP TCP
IP IP IP IP
Túnel GTP
Portadora EPS
Paquete IP/IP
Portadora SGi
Backbone IP Internet
Radio PGW
eNB
…
PGW
eNB SGW
eNB
TS 23.203
Funciones:
– Soporte básico de sesiones AAA entre clientes y servidores
• basado en intercambio de AVPs (Attribute Value Pairs)
• transporte fiable, entrega de mensajes y manejo de errores
• autenticación de usuarios y negociación de capacidades
– Soporte de extensiones (Aplicaciones Diameter) mediante nuevos
comandos y AVPs
• Del IETF, de empresas u otros organismos (ej, 3GPP)
Application Application
Nodes
Identifier (Interface)
16777251 S6a/S6d MME/S4‐SGSN ↔ HSS
EPC
16777252 S13/S13' MME/S4‐SGSN ↔ EIR
16777236 Rx PCRF ↔ AF
PCC 16777238 Gx PCRF ↔ PGW
16777267 S9 vPCRF ↔ HPCRF
16777216 Cx/Dx S‐CSCF/I‐CSCF ↔ HSS
IMS
16777217 Sh/Dh AS ↔ HSS
Introducción
Arquitectura
Protocolos
Procedimientos
Gestión de Establecimiento, modificación y liberación de portadoras EPS (por
Gestión de portadoras EPS defecto y dedicadas), siempre a instancias de la red.
sesiones
(ESM) Gestión de Establecimiento, modificación y liberación de sesiones de datos con
conexiones PDN redes externas a instancias del terminal (estilo GPRS/UMTS)
Introducción
Arquitectura
Protocolos
Procedimientos
– Gestión de recursos radio
– Gestión de Movilidad
– Gestión de sesiones
Introducción
Arquitectura
Protocolos
Procedimientos
– Gestión de recursos radio
– Gestión de Movilidad
– Gestión de sesiones
EMM Registered
Attach
S6a HSS
MME
S1-C S11
Red de datos
S1-U S5 SGi
UE por defecto
eNodeB SGW PGW (ej. IMS)
USIM
Descarga de vectores
Acceso aleatorio de autenticación (AVs)
USIM
Mensaje inicial
AV(KASME, RAND, AUTN, XRES)
Verifica AUTN
Calcula RES, CK, IK Authentication Request
(RAND, AUTN, KSIASME)
Autenticación bidireccional
Vectores de
MME Autenticación HSS
Cifrado e integridad de
señalización RRC en i/f radio S1-C
S1-U
USIM SGW
ME eNodeB
Equipo de Usuario
Cifrado de datos de Cifrado opcional de datos de
usuario en i/f radio usuario en S1-U
CK Clave de cifrado
IK Clave de integridad
KASME Entidad de gestión de claves de seguridad
KNAS enc Clave de cifrado para señalización NAS
KNAS int Clave de integridad para señalización NAS
KUP enc Clave de cifrado i/f radio para datos de usuario
KRRC enc Clave de cifrado para señalización RRC
KRRC int Clave de integridad para señalización RRC
MME
S1-C S11
S1-U S5 SGi Red de
SGW PGW datos
UE eNodeB
ECM-
CONNECTED
Detach, Inactivity Timer, General failure, …
S1 UE Context
Release Request
Release Access
Bearers Request Liberación de recursos
Release Access plano usuario (S1-U)
Bearers Response
S1 UE Context
Release Command
RRC Connection Liberación de recursos
ECM-IDLE Release plano de control (S1-C)
S1 UE Context
Release Complete
Plano de
control
MME
S1-C S11
S1-U S5
SGW PGW
UE eNodeB
Plano de
usuario
Service Request
ECM-
Datos en sentido ascendente
CONNECTED
Initial Context Setup Complete Modify Bearer Req
Stop Paging
Datos en sentido descendente
Principios:
– Móvil elige en todo momento la célula que le proporciona mejor señal
en base a medidas periódicas
– Si la nueva célula pertenece a otra área de seguimiento (Tracking
Area), ejecuta procedimiento de actualización de posición
• Dos casos: con o sin cambio de MME
Móvil puede estar registrado en varias TAs contiguas (listas de TAIs asignada
por la red)
– Reduce señalización en fronteras de TAs, evitando actualizaciones contínuas y
consumo de batería (sobre todo si movilidad alta)
TAI2 TAI3
TAI2 TAI2
– Identificador temporal S-TMSI
TAI1
(Serving TMSI) TAI2
TAI1 TAI1
– Nueva lista de TAIs
TAI1
HSS
5. Update
S6a Location Ack
4. Cancel Location / Ack
3. Update
Location Req.
Si no hay cambio de MME (TA1 y
TA2 cubiertos por mismo MME),
los pasos 2 a 5 innecesarios
2. Context Request/Response
MME
MME
S10
S1-C S1-C
UE eNodeB
eNodeB
antiguo nuevo
SGi
Liberación del
PGW
trayecto antiguo
S5 S5
X2 eNodeB
eNodeB
antiguo nuevo
UE
Introducción
Arquitectura
Protocolos
Procedimientos
– Gestión de recursos radio
– Gestión de Movilidad
– Gestión de sesiones
MME Gx PCRF Rx
S1-C S11
S5 AF Red externa
S1-U SGi (ej. CSCF)
SGW PGW (ej. IMS)
UE eNodeB
INVITE
100 Trying Señalización a nivel de aplicación sobre
portadora por defecto
100 Ringing (ej. establecimiento. de sesión IMS)
200 OK
ACK
36.201 LTE Physical Layer General Description 36.401 E-UTRAN Architecture Description
36.211 Physical Channels and Modulation 36.410 S1 General Aspects and Principles
RAN1 36.212 Multiplexing and Channel Coding 36.411 S1 Layer 1
36.213 Physical Layer Procedures 36.412 S1 Signalling Transport
36.214 Physical Layer Measurements 36.413 S1 Protocol Specification
36.300 E-UTRAN Overall Description Stage 2 RAN3 36.414 S1 Data Transport
36.302 E-UTRAN Services Provided by the Physical Layer 36.420 X2 General Aspects and Principles
36.304 User Equipment (UE) Procedures in Idle Mode
36.421 X2 Layer 1
36.306 User Equipment (UE) Radio Access Capabilities
RAN2 36.422 X2 Signalling Transport
36.321 Medium Access Control (MAC) Protocol Specification
36.322 Radio Link Control (RLC) Protocol Specification
36.423 X2 Protocol Specification
36.323 Packet Data Convergence Protocol (PDCP) Specification
36.424 X2 Data Transport
36.331 Radio Resource Control (RRC) Protocol Specification 24.801 3GPP System Architecture Evolution CT WG1 Aspects
22.278 Service Requirements for the Evolved Packet System 29.804 CT WG3 Aspect of 3GPP System Architecture Evolution
23.401 GPRS Enhancements for E-UTRAN Access 29.803 3GPP System Architecture Evolution CT WG4 Aspects
Technical
23.402 Architecture Enhancements for Non-3GPP Accesses 32.816 Study on Management of LTE and SAE
SA2 Reports
24.301 Non-Access-Stratum (NAS) protocol for EPS 32.820 Study on Charging Aspects of 3GPP System Evolution
29.060 GPRS Tunnelling Protocol (GTP) across Gn &Gp (Rel8) 33.821 Rationale and Track of Security Decisions in LTE/SAE
29.274 Evolved GPRS Tunnelling Protocol for EPS (GTPv2) 23.882 3GPP System Architecture Evolution (Release 7)
www.3gpp.org
Marzo 2015 Curso LTE ‐ ISDEFE
88
Lista de siglas